Charity Pierce, Star of 'My 600-lb Life,' Dies at 50
Charity Pierce, known for her appearance on TLC's "My 600-lb Life," passed away on Tuesday at 1:20 AM. She was 50 years old.
A family source reported that Pierce had been in hospice care for one to two months due to ongoing medical conditions. These included lymphedema and fluid buildup in her lungs, which may have contributed to her death.
Her daughter, Charly Jo, confirmed the death on Facebook, stating she was with her mother when she died.

Journey on "My 600-lb Life"
Pierce gained public attention during Season 3 of "My 600-lb Life," where she addressed severe obesity and associated health complications. At her peak weight, she was close to 800 pounds before seeking professional medical assistance.
Her journey on the show involved significant weight loss and skin removal surgeries. She also experienced setbacks, including infections and personal struggles.
Pierce later appeared in "My 600-lb Life: Where Are They Now?" This documented her continuing health challenges and efforts to reconcile with family members, including Charly.
Recent Health Challenges
In recent years, Pierce faced additional medical issues, including a kidney cancer diagnosis that necessitated surgery.
An official cause of death has not been released.
